CL 09, M23: Final: NSW v. T&T: Brett Lee, Boss in Final! NSW wins CL 09!

Brett Lee, was the boss in final! His heroics won the Champions League trophy for New South Wales lead by Simon Katich.

Put into bat, Hughes went for 3. Warner took most of the strike and gave just 4 deliveries to Hughes in 3 overs. Trying to maintain the run rate, he played across and lost his stumps.

Warner followed him to the pavilion in the next over for just 19. Katich scored just 16 and Henriques 4. S Smith alone made good contribution at the top with 33. New South Wales were 75 for 5 in 10.1 overs.

Wicket Keeper D Smith was bowled by Rampual for 3 which gave T&T a good chance to restrict the NSW. Brett Lee joined S Smith when the score was 83 for 6 in 11.2 overs.

Brett Lee took charge and played marvellous shots along the ground and also over the ropes. He cleared the rope 5 times and hit only one four. Both Smith and Lee took on Simmons and scored 23 from his 2 overs.

Rampual was the pick of the bowler with 3 for 20 in his 4. Dwyne Bravo also picked 2 wickets.

Chasing 160, the safe bet was in favor of T&T. They have chased above 170 couple of times, including 171 against NSW in their league encounter.

But, Brett Lee had a different story to write. He had Perkins stumps dislocated. He moved and tried to hit it over covers and missed straight delivery.

In the 2nd over, Barath hit two fours and a six in the first 3 balls. He chased a wide delivery only to get a thin under edge and give a simple catch to D Smith. That was a poor shot as 15 runs have already come out of that over.

Lee took a wonderful return catch to dismiss dangerous Simmons for just 4. T&T were 21 for 3 in 2.2 overs.

The Bravo-Ganga pair, which won the Semi Final against Cape Cobras steadied the innings. They did not want to lose another wicket. They managed to add 24 more runs to the total. When it was going good, Bravo tried to push the ball loosely but ended up dragging it to the stumps. Big break through from Bollinger.

Ganga was caught in the last ball of the 10th over for 19. T&T were struggling at half-way mark. They needed one more big innings from Pollard.

T&T needed 92 from 60 balls. As exected Pollard damaged the NSW bowling attack. He hit huge sixes sending the ball to 2nd tier.

Ramdin was caught at point trying to steer to third man. S Ganga and Pollard got out in the same over. Pollard hit two sixes of Harutiz. In the last ball of the over, going for the third six, he mistimed it an ballooned it long on. Brett Lee was in picture once again taking a good catch to relieve the New South Wales team and their supporters.

Stuart Clark dismissed Stewart and Mohammed in the next over. This is the first time T&T were dismissed in less than 20 overs.

NSW clinched the first edition of the Champions League, thanks to all-round performance from Brett Lee--48 from 31 balls with 1 four and 5 sixes; 2 for 10 in 2 overs; and took 2 catches.

He was awarded both man of the match and also the series.

CL 09, M22: SF 2: T&T v. CC: Bravo takes T&T to Final!

What a brilliant innings from Dwayne Bravo? A match-winning preformance at a crucial stage which took Trinad and Tobago to the final. T&T will play against New South Wales on Friday.

Chasing a stiff target of 176, the start was good with Perkins and Barath adding 53 in 5 overs. Perkins got run out for 20. It was a peculiar run out! Barath played the ball to point, the direct hit from Puttick knocked the stumps and rebound. Perkins went for a run but Baranth stood his ground. He was half the way. The ball was easily passed on to Lee and he takes the stump with the ball.

Barath was trapped leg before off Duminy for 29, adding just 5 runs with Simmons. No big contribution came from the first top 3 batsmen.

Simmons got out for 20 when the score was 85 in 10 overs. One should say that Simmons did not utilize the chances given to him by Cape Cobra fielder Davis. He dropped two chances--one was a sitter on 11, and hard chance on 14. Kleinveldt did not make the same mistake when offered the chance. He grabbed a straight catch at deep midwicket off Ontong.

T&T needed 91 in 65 balls with Bravo joining the party with Skipper Ganga. Bravo was dropped on 17 by Ontong at long on off Duminy. The drop catch turned the match and took it away from Cape Cobras.

Bravo then went on to score unbetaen 58 in just 34 balls which had 4 fours and 3 sixes. Ganga was on 44 not out and built a good winning partnership of 93 runs in 55 balls as T&T won with 4 balls remaining.

Earlier, Bravo picked was smashed in his 3 overs for 46 runs. He was the costly bowlers and Cape Cobras picked him very well. Bravo took a revenge and should be a happy man.

For Cape Cobras, Gibbs scored runs, for a change. His 42 came in 27 balls with 5 fours and a six. He hit 4 fours in single over from Bravo.

It was Duminy, who took charge of the innings and made a wonderful 61. He picked the spots very well and hit 3 huge sixes and also 4 fours.

Simmons was the most economical bowler picking 2 wickets in 3 overs giving away 17 runs.

CL 09, M11: B: Eag v. Sus: Eagles beat Sussex in Super Over Thriller!

What a match? The match of the tournament so far! The team that wins the match qualifies for the super 8. Both the teams scored 119 and the match moved towards super over (one-over elimination).

The rules of the Super Over:

Each team nominates three batsmen and one bowler;
If they lose two wickets the innings (of six balls) is considered over;
If it's another tie, the team with most number of sixes in the Eliminator wins;
If that's also equal, it's the team with the most sixes in the match that wins (Sussex has three sixes, Eagles have two).

Super Over:

Eagles batted first with Rossouw and Ryan McLaren. Yasir Arafat, who bowled the 20th over had the ball in hand.

Rossuouw and McLaren scored a single each in the first two balls. Third ball was a dot ball. Rossouw hit a six over long on. Yasir bowled a little wide on the off and got a dot ball. Last ball was a single and Eagles ended with 9 runs.

de Villiers struck with the first two balls and finished the match in favor of Eagles. He had Dwayne Smith clean bowled uprooting his off stump. With just one more wicket in hand, 5 balls, 10 runs needed. Hamilton-Brown was also dismissed the same way--looked like a replay. Eagles qualified for the super 8 by 9 runs.

Scores Tied

Chasing 120, Rossouw took Eagles closer to the target. He scored a wonderful 65 which gave hopes to Eagles. His innings had 7 fours and 2 sixes in 62 balls.

Rossouw and Ryan McLaren gave a good start with a 72-run partnership for the first wicket in 11.1 overs. Ryan scored just 16 of those while Rossouw touched his 50 (in 39 balls).

Eagles needed 46 in 8 overs with 9 wickets in hand. The collapse started after Wyk was caught by Joyce off Chawla for 2. 39 needed off 6 overs with 8 wickets in hand.

Two overs needed 17. Hamilton-Brown bowled a good tight over which went for 5 runs. The key turning point was the crucial wicket of Rossouw, caught behind.

Last over needed 12 runs, Yasir Arafat had the ball. The first 3 balls went for single. McLaren hit a four through an inner edge which went to a four in fine leg. Nobody can set a field set for the french cut.

Last two balls required 5 runs. Arafat bowled a brilliant yorker on the wide off stump which went to keeper.

One ball, 5 runs, Ryan McLaren was again on strike. The delivery pitched on length was clubbed to the wide-long on boundary. Though for a moment everyone thought that it was a six, it was actually a boundary which forced a tie.

Sussex Innings

Deciding to bat first, Sussex did not utilize the batting conditions. No batsmen could make merry as the highest score was 25 by number 7 batsmen J Gatting. C de Villiers and du Preez picked 2 wickets each. The bowlers maintained it tight and did not allow the batsmen to improvise the scoring rate.

Super 8 Qualification

With this win, Eagles qualified for the super 8. New South Wales already qualifed by winning both their matches convincingly.
